The rotary axes in trunnion-model machines are expressed by using the movement of the table, Whilst swivel-rotate-model machines Categorical their rotary axes by swiveling the spindle. The two styles have their very own one of a kind strengths.

A result of the motions Employed in 5 Axis machining, the machines usually Slice one element at a time. Thus, an operator has to load and unload the machine for each specific section. This can be in contrast to 3 axis machining, exactly where a number of parts are machined at the same time
